2009 Land Rover Defender vs. 1987 Mazda 626

To start off, 2009 Land Rover Defender is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Mazda 626.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Mazda 626 would be higher. At 2,402 cc (4 cylinders), 2009 Land Rover Defender is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Land Rover Defender (120 HP @ 3500 RPM) has 31 more horse power than 1987 Mazda 626. (89 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2009 Land Rover Defender should accelerate faster than 1987 Mazda 626.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Land Rover Defender weights approximately 1588 kg more than 1987 Mazda 626.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2009 Land Rover Defender is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1987 Mazda 626.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Land Rover Defender will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Land Rover Defender (360 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 226 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Mazda 626. (134 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 2009 Land Rover Defender will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Mazda 626.
